How to choose an angle grinder for your home or garden correctly

In order to make the right choice of a grinding machine that meets all the necessary requirements, it is necessary to determine the tasks that will be assigned to it. Most importantly, determine what you will be cutting with the angle grinder, and how often.

As practice shows, for home and summer cottages, household angle grinders with a working disc size of 125 mm and a power of up to 1.5 kW are best suited. These machines are lightweight and lightweight, easy to operate, and equipped with additional features. For a wheel diameter of 125 mm, many additional attachments have been released that turn the angle grinder into a universal tool.

Scratch disk size

Disc diameter is the main indicator of the ability of an angle grinder to perform certain operations. The larger the cutting wheel size, the more powerful and faster the angle grinder should be. The diameter of the hole in the circle (landing size) is standard: 22.2 mm.

There are five standard types of discs available for the angle grinder, differing in size:

  • Disc with a diameter of 115 mm. Designed for cutting materials of small thickness, for processing (grinding, polishing) small surfaces. The maximum cutting depth is approx. 30 mm.
  • Disc with a diameter of 125 mm. One of the most popular sizes for household use. The cutting depth is about 40 mm. A wide variety of attachments and accessories are produced for this size.
  • Disc with a diameter of 150 mm. Most often it is used in installation work as an auxiliary tool. Common size for cutting metal and plastic pipes for plumbing and electrical work.
  • Disc with a diameter of 180 mm. Semi-professional size. Assumes non-stop operation. The cutting edge is 50 mm. It is widely used in repair and construction works.
  • Disc diameter 230 mm. Used in professional angle grinders up to 2.5 kW. For household needs, devices that are too bulky are practically not used.

Disk rotation speed

In angle grinders, the rotation speed of the working shaft varies from 2.5 to 12 thousand revolutions per minute. The working range is in the range from 3000 to 6000 rpm. As a rule, the manufacturer sets the optimum rotation speed for his machine depending on the motor power, and sets this parameter at the design stage.

High-end angle grinders are equipped with a working shaft speed regulator. This adjustment is especially relevant when changing discs frequently. For example, when a disc with a diameter of 230 mm rotates at a frequency of 10 thousand rpm, it will be very difficult to hold the tool in your hands.

Than one another better compare similar models

For a detailed comparison, let’s take the most popular models from both manufacturers with similar technical characteristics:

  1. Angle grinder Makita GA9020SF with a mains motor power of 2.2 kW and an admissible disc diameter of 230 mm.
  2. Bosch GWS 22-230 JH angle grinder with the same power of 2.2 kW and the same outer disc diameter of 230 mm.

As you can see, the power of the drives is the same, which makes it possible to saw and grind with large wheels with a diameter of 230. Bosch and Makita cost the same, the price is the same, about 3.5 thousand UAH.

What do we get for such a cost:

  • Reliable brushed motor with excellent power, Makita has more revving 6600 rpm;
  • Robust dustproof housing;
  • Adjustable protective cover;
  • Reliable fastening with a turnkey clamping nut;
  • Two handles front, which can be installed and fixed in three positions, and the back without adjustment;
  • Three-year manufacturer’s warranty;
  • Automatic shutdown when the disk is jammed.

As for the set of electronic additional functions, both grinders have a soft start and speed control (spindle speed).

The German manufacturer took care of safety and ruled out unintentional restarting, the Bosch angle grinder has a lock button. But the Japanese angle grinder includes another very important function of maintaining constant engine speed. This means that the motor torque does not drop even when the unit is used at maximum load. Simply put, such an angle grinder will not stall, the revolutions will not drop, the power will not decrease, which is very important when cutting thick metal, with rough grinding.

When comparing the weight, it can be seen that the Makita angle grinder is slightly heavier, but it clearly wins in terms of comfort when working. She has an anti-vibration system installed. As a result, we get:

  • Less vibration during stripping (2.5 versus 3.5 for Bosch) and when sanding (6 versus 7.5 for Bosch);
  • Lower sound pressure level.

Angle grinder power

The heart of any power tool engine. Its power consumption ranges from 500 to 2600 watts. It affects:

  1. Type and time of work;
  2. Weight;
  3. Tool cost.

For example, when choosing an angle grinder for your home or garage workshop (for cutting and grinding a metal surface), a power of 600 to 800 watts is perfect. It will be light and easy to use.

If you want to cut or grind concrete, the power must be at least 1000 watts. It is perfect if you plan to work on a small area.

However, for a large amount of work, the power should not be less than 1400 watts.
